1 large can of cooked chicken
8oz cream cheese, softened
1 small size bottle of buffalo chicken wing sauce
1 bottle of blue cheese dressing

In a saucepan combine the cream cheese and buffalo chicken sauce, stir until smooth and creamy. Add chicken, drain first, and heat. The stir in the blue cheese dressing. Serve warm, with crackers or celery sticks. I have used club, ritz or the chicken biscuit crackers. Taste just like buffalo wings, without the mess!

Pepperoni rolls:

Package refridgerated crescent rolls
Pepperoni pillow pack
Shredded mozz. cheese

Open rolls, separate. Place a few slices pepperoni, sprinkle with cheese. Roll them up so that they are sealed. Place on ungreased cookie sheet (I like the pampered chef stone) and bake as directed on the package.

Serve with pizza dipping sauce. Easy and yummy!

Water chestnuts & bacon:

Cut uncooked bacon slices in half. Wrap each 1/2 slice around a whole water chestnut & secure with a toothpick.

Broil until bacon is crispy.

Cheese Crustini (makes 100)

Baguette Bread--1 sliced thin
Cream cheese--1 lb. 9 oz.
Jack cheese--5 oz.
Swiss cheese--5 oz.
Asiago or parmesan--5 oz.
Mozzarella Cheese--5 oz.
Cream or half & half--1/4 cup
Mixed herbs--any type you prefer. I usually use some sort of Italian herbs

Spray the bread slices with a flavored pan spray, such as garlic or olive oil. Toast in oven at 400 for about 3 minutes. They should only be dried a bit, not browned.
Beat cream cheese in mixer until soft. Add remaining cheese (all shredded). Mix well. This with cream. Add herbs to taste. Remember that the flavor will become stronger as it sits. I sometimes add hot sauce to the mix.

When ready for serving, place a small scoop of cheese on each Crustini. Heat in oven until cheese melts. Some like them a little browned but this will make the crustinis quite crunchy. Your preference.

Hope you enjoy it. The cheese mix will stay good for quite a while in the fridge. The crustinis don't last more than a few days, though.
 
Pizza Dip is one of my most favorite appetizers and it's always a hit.

1 Jar Pizza Sauce
1 Package of Cream Cheese
Italian Mix of Cheese
Italian Seasoning

Spread the cream cheese on the bottom of a baking pan, sprinkle italian seasoning over it, cover with a layer of cheese. Then pour pizza sauce on top, speading evenly around. Top of with remaining cheese. Bake at 350 for approx. 20 minutes or until cheese bubbles.

Serve with slices of french bread.

Men love this recipe:

1 package of Bob Evans mild sausage
Velveeta cheese (I buy it in the jar)
1 package of party pumpernickel bread

Cook sausage in skillet, breaking it up into small pieces as it cooks with the back of a spoon. Drain grease. Lower heat and add in the cheese; stir until melted. Spoon sausage/cheese mixture over each slice of bread (1 tablespoon per slice) and place slices on a cookie sheet. Bake at 350 for 10 minutes. I make these at my friend's annual NYE's party and I barely get them out of the oven before they are eaten.

Cream Cheese Ball
2 pkgs. Cream Cheese (you can make one lite)
1 can of crushed pineapple, drained (tunafish can size)
green pepper or red pepper( or both) cut into small pieces
chopped walnuts

mix together cream cheese, pineapple and pepper. Form into a ball. Roll this into the nuts. Wrap loosely in tinfoil and refrig for at least a few hours or best over night.

This is great to serve with Fritos scoops or crackers

BLT DIP
1 lb bacon
1 tomato
1 c sour cream
1 c mayo (we use Miracle Whip)

Fry bacon till crisp; drain and crumble. Combine sour cream and mayo; add bacon. Seed and chop tomato - stir tomato in just before serving (otherwise it gets watery). Serve with Fritos, Triscuits, wheat thins, really any cracker works with this dip.

(and yes, you can use fat-free sour cream/Miracle Whip if you'd like!)

One of our favorites: Fried Ravioli

Use package of fresh cheese ravioli (not frozen!). Heat oil - need enough to cover ravioli (I usually use our fry daddy). Fry ravioli in hot oil (in small batches of approx. 8 - 10) until lightly browned (only takes a minute or two!). Remove with slotted spoon, place on paper towels to absorb excess oil. Sprinkle with Parmesan cheese and Italian seasonings. Serve warm with marinara or other favorite spag. sauce. Delicious!!!
